The 2021 Tom Spangler Golf Classic was a huge success due to the tremendous support of the Knox County community. Supporters sponsored each hole and volunteers helped make sure the event ran like clockwork.

Fountain City Finance, King Cleaners, Cedar Bluff Towing, and Garza Law Firm were the title sponsors.

Although it was a cloudy and rainy day, golfers teed up and enjoyed some golf and fellowship on the beautiful Three Ridges Golf Course. Phil Williams of Talk Radio 98.7 in Knoxville came out to play as well as other local leaders.
